Eastman Kodak Company (Kodak) is engaged in the sale of imaging products, technology, solutions and services to consumers, businesses and professionals. Kodak operates in three segments: Consumer Digital Imaging Group (CDG), Graphic Communications Group (GCG) and Film, Photofinishing and Entertainment Group (FPEG). The Company's products span digital still and video cameras and related accessories; consumer inkjet printers and media; digital picture frames; retail printing kiosks, APEX drylab systems and related media and services, and KODAK Gallery online imaging services. Kodak's products also include prepress equipment and consumables and imaging sensors. In March 2011, the Company acquired Tokyo Ohka Kogyo Co., Ltd. In November 2011, it sold its Image Sensor Solutions (ISS) business to Platinum Equity.
